read the original abstract

This paper describes a novel method to increase the resistive Tc of cuprate superconductors to values that might approach room temperature if the method is applied to the so-called underdoped regime. This involves ordering the dopants that provide the holes as well as provide pair breaking. The strategy is to separate the doped regions with lower Tc from metallic but undoped regions with the higher Tc.
